SSH到Azure的Kubernetes托pipe主节点
我刚刚使用Azure容器服务部署了一个托pipe的Kubernetes集群。 我的部署包括托pipe群集上的单个代理计算机和连接到它的Azure磁盘以进行持久存储。
我面对的问题是,我不知道如何ssh这个代理服务器。 我读过,你应该能够ssh的主节点,并从那里连接到代理,但因为我正在使用托pipe的Kubernetes主,我无法find这样做的方式。
任何想法? 先谢谢你。
我面对的问题是,我不知道如何ssh这个代理服务器。
你的意思是你创buildAKS并找不到主虚拟机?
如果我理解正确,这是一个devise行为,AKS不提供对群集的直接访问(如使用SSH)。
如果您想SSH代理节点,作为一种解决方法,我们可以创build一个公共IP地址 , 并将此公共IP地址关联到代理的NIC,然后我们可以SSH到这个代理。
这是我的步骤:
1.通过Azure门户创build公共IP地址:
2.将公共IP地址与代理VM的NIC相关联:
3.使用此公共IP地址与此VM进行SSH连接:
注意:
默认情况下,当我们尝试创buildAKS时,我们可以findssh密钥,如下所示:
- 如何使用docker-machine和VirtualBox创build具有特定URL的Docker机器?
- 在docker容器中运行的Python程序依赖于'uname -r'
- 在一个Docker容器中运行两个进程,或者两个容器连接到同一个数据库?
- Docker连接容器
- Docker不能与Windows上的encryption硬盘绑定
- 从主机访问Docker容器的本地主机
- 如何知道泊坞窗容器是否在特权模式下运行
- Kubernetes以部署+ rbd模式创build服务,同样configuration成在默认名称空间下成功,在非默认名称空间下失败?
- 如何通过Java程序直接与Docker守护进程交互(绕过terminal)